Ticket: Config drift on Harrowfield telemetry gateway

Plugin authors: staging and prod gateways have drifted. Ingest batch sizes and retry windows differ, so plugins tuned against staging are timing out in prod. Do not hand-tune around this; we are resetting both environments to a single canonical config this week. Any plugin assuming the old staging values must be updated. The canonical gateway configuration we are converging on follows.

settings of fafog-haduf:
ZORIX_PIN=4648
ZORIX_METRICS_HOST=metrics.zorix.paliqsys.corp
ZORIX_LOG_LEVEL=info
ZORIX_TENANT=druix

The garage occupancy feed for the Brindlewood campus arrives over a message queue every thirty seconds, one record per level, published by the Stallgrid edge boxes. Counts can briefly go negative when a sensor double-fires on exit; the ingest job clamps these to zero and flags the interval. If the feed stalls for more than five minutes, the dashboard falls back to the last known snapshot. Sensor mappings, queue names, and the replay procedure are documented on the internal page below.

runbook for tahog-kadug: https://gitlab.qirvanworks.corp/projects/pages/view/b139298aed28

Runbook: ReportForge sort stability. Plugin authors: the column sorter in ReportForge 4.x is stable; equal keys retain input order. Do not re-sort downstream or grouping breaks. If a tenant reports shuffled rows, check for a custom comparator in the plugin manifest first. To reproduce locally, pull fixtures from the Quillbank staging mirror. The mirror requires the key below.

gateway credential: kto3_qfe